Discovering Chew Cottage

Chew Cottage is an important historic building. It stands at 19 Ottawa Road in Ngaio, a suburb of Wellington. This charming house helps us understand the early days of settlement in New Zealand.

A Glimpse into the Past

The house was built in 1865. It was originally named "Millwood." John and Ester Chew were the first owners of this lovely home. Imagine living in a house built so long ago!

Chew Cottage is one of the few houses left in Wellington from the 1860s. This makes it very rare and valuable. It shows us how people built homes back then.

English Style, New Zealand Materials

The design of Chew Cottage looks a lot like a traditional English stone cottage. However, instead of stone, it was built using timber. This shows how early settlers adapted building styles. They used materials that were easy to find in New Zealand.

Why Chew Cottage is Special

Chew Cottage is officially recognized as a "Category I" historic place. This classification comes from Heritage New Zealand. A "Category I" place means it has "special or outstanding historical or cultural heritage significance or value."
